Elton Manor - An entertaining haven replete with swimming pool and cinema room, wrapped up in almost an acre and a half of mature, landscaped gardens, make lasting memories at Sutton Lane, in the pretty village of Elton.
Built in 2012 on the site of the former gamekeeper?s cottage for the original Elton Manor, a grand stately home, demolished in 1939, luxury, comfort and convenience combine at Sutton Lane.

On Your Doorstep - Nestled in the exclusive Vale of Belvoir, Elton is a delightful rural village around 14 miles east of Nottingham. Pop the dog on a lead and explore the many idyllic canal walks on your doorstep.
Less than seven minutes away in the neighbouring village of Bottesford are both a secondary and primary school, whilst the boys? and girls? grammar schools are available in nearby Grantham. For independent education, the esteemed Colston Bassett School and Salterford House School are a respective 18- and 28-minutes? drive away.
Schooling is also available in nearby Bingham, where there is also a leisure centre, and shopping facilities.
The village of Elton itself is home to the historic St Michael?s and All Angels church, whilst there is a pub and restaurant in the neighbouring village.
Commuters are perfectly placed for travel into Nottingham, Leicester, Grantham and beyond via the A1, A46, A52 and M1. Catch a train into London from Grantham Station, only 12 minutes away, in no more than an hour and 15 minutes. Newark Station is also equidistant.
